Revenge bedtime procrastination: Why you stay up late even when you’re exhausted and how to win over this habit

Revenge bedtime procrastination is the habit of delaying sleep to reclaim personal time after a demanding day. While it may feel like control, it leads to chronic fatigue and health risks. By setting device limits, creating calming routines, and protecting personal time earlier in the evening, people can rebuild healthier sleep patterns and improve long-term well-being.
